Mark Edward Wilkinson, 74, passed away Tuesday, April 17, 2018 while at UPMC Presbyterian Hospital. The son of Harry “Bud” and Eleanor Jean (Scott) Wilkinson, he was born October 1, 1943 in Altoona. Mark was employed in the construction industry and as an iron worker. He enjoyed carpentry and following school sports, and he loved spending time with his family and his dog.
